| /drivers/gpu/drm/ci/xfails/ |
| A D | vkms-none-fails.txt | 19 kms_writeback@writeback-check-output,Fail 20 kms_writeback@writeback-check-output-XRGB2101010,Fail 21 kms_writeback@writeback-fb-id,Fail 22 kms_writeback@writeback-fb-id-XRGB2101010,Fail 23 kms_writeback@writeback-invalid-parameters,Fail 24 kms_writeback@writeback-pixel-formats,Fail
|
| /drivers/gpu/drm/vkms/ |
| A D | vkms_config.h | 70 bool writeback; member 328 return crtc_cfg->writeback; in vkms_config_crtc_get_writeback() 338 bool writeback) in vkms_config_crtc_set_writeback() argument 340 crtc_cfg->writeback = writeback; in vkms_config_crtc_set_writeback()
|
| A D | vkms_output.c | 16 int writeback; in vkms_output_init() local 48 writeback = vkms_enable_writeback_connector(vkmsdev, crtc_cfg->crtc); in vkms_output_init() 49 if (writeback) in vkms_output_init()
|
| /drivers/gpu/drm/renesas/rcar-du/ |
| A D | rcar_du_writeback.c | 203 struct drm_writeback_connector *wb_conn = &rcrtc->writeback; in rcar_du_writeback_init() 225 state = rcrtc->writeback.base.state; in rcar_du_writeback_setup() 240 drm_writeback_queue_job(&rcrtc->writeback, state); in rcar_du_writeback_setup() 245 drm_writeback_signal_completion(&rcrtc->writeback, 0); in rcar_du_writeback_complete()
|
| A D | rcar_du_crtc.h | 75 struct drm_writeback_connector writeback; member 79 #define wb_to_rcar_crtc(c) container_of(c, struct rcar_du_crtc, writeback)
|
| A D | rcar_du_vsp.c | 110 rcar_du_writeback_setup(crtc, &cfg.writeback); in rcar_du_vsp_atomic_flush()
|
| /drivers/media/platform/renesas/vsp1/ |
| A D | vsp1_wpf.c | 254 if (!pipe->iif && (!pipe->lif || wpf->writeback)) { in wpf_configure_stream() 358 if (wpf->writeback) { in wpf_configure_stream() 361 wpf->writeback = false; in wpf_configure_stream() 365 wpf->writeback ? VI6_WPF_WRBCK_CTRL_WBMD : 0); in wpf_configure_stream() 431 if (pipe->lif && !wpf->writeback) in wpf_configure_partition() 525 wpf->writeback = false; in wpf_configure_partition()
|
| A D | vsp1_rwpf.h | 64 bool writeback; member
|
| A D | vsp1_drm.c | 559 if (pipe->output->writeback) in vsp1_du_pipeline_configure() 909 if (cfg->writeback.pixelformat) { in vsp1_du_atomic_flush() 910 const struct vsp1_du_writeback_config *wb_cfg = &cfg->writeback; in vsp1_du_atomic_flush() 921 pipe->output->writeback = true; in vsp1_du_atomic_flush()
|
| /drivers/gpu/drm/ttm/ |
| A D | ttm_backup.c | 97 bool writeback, pgoff_t idx, gfp_t page_gfp, in ttm_backup_backup_page() argument 115 if (writeback && !folio_mapped(to_folio) && in ttm_backup_backup_page()
|
| A D | ttm_bo_util.c | 1106 .writeback = flags.writeback}); in ttm_bo_shrink()
|
| /drivers/gpu/drm/xe/ |
| A D | xe_shrinker.c | 112 save_flags.writeback = false; in xe_shrinker_walk() 128 if (flags.writeback) { in xe_shrinker_walk() 212 .writeback = !ctx.no_wait_gpu && (sc->gfp_mask & __GFP_IO), in xe_shrinker_scan()
|
| A D | xe_bo.h | 418 u32 writeback : 1; member
|
| /drivers/block/zram/ |
| A D | Kconfig | 116 With /sys/block/zramX/{idle,writeback}, application could ask 117 idle page's writeback to the backing device to save in memory. 127 pages writeback.
|
| /drivers/md/bcache/ |
| A D | request.c | 176 if (op->writeback) in bch_data_insert_endio() 224 op->writeback)) in CLOSURE_CALLBACK() 232 if (op->writeback) { in CLOSURE_CALLBACK() 256 BUG_ON(op->writeback); in CLOSURE_CALLBACK() 313 op->writeback, op->bypass); in CLOSURE_CALLBACK() 666 if (unlikely(s->iop.writeback && in backing_request_endio() 997 s->iop.writeback = true; in cached_dev_write() 1014 s->iop.writeback = true; in cached_dev_write() 1029 } else if (s->iop.writeback) { in cached_dev_write() 1324 s->iop.writeback = true; in flash_dev_submit_bio()
|
| A D | Makefile | 7 util.o writeback.o features.o
|
| A D | request.h | 21 unsigned int writeback:1; member
|
| A D | movinggc.c | 104 op->writeback = KEY_DIRTY(&io->w->key); in CLOSURE_CALLBACK()
|
| /drivers/gpu/drm/amd/display/dc/dml2/dml21/inc/bounding_boxes/ |
| A D | dcn4_soc_bb.h | 49 .writeback = { 175 .writeback = {
|
| /drivers/gpu/drm/amd/display/dc/dml2/ |
| A D | display_mode_core.c | 6877 …|| mode_lib->ms.cache_display_cfg.writeback.WritebackHRatio[k] > (dml_uint_t) mode_lib->ms.cache_d… in dml_core_mode_support() 6878 …|| mode_lib->ms.cache_display_cfg.writeback.WritebackVRatio[k] > (dml_uint_t) mode_lib->ms.cache_d… in dml_core_mode_support() 6879 …|| (mode_lib->ms.cache_display_cfg.writeback.WritebackHTaps[k] > 2.0 && ((mode_lib->ms.cache_displ… in dml_core_mode_support() 7852 mode_lib->ms.cache_display_cfg.writeback.WritebackVTaps[k], in dml_core_mode_support() 8341 if (mode_lib->ms.cache_display_cfg.writeback.WritebackEnable[k]) { in dml_core_mode_programming() 8350 mode_lib->ms.cache_display_cfg.writeback.WritebackHTaps[k], in dml_core_mode_programming() 8351 mode_lib->ms.cache_display_cfg.writeback.WritebackVTaps[k], in dml_core_mode_programming() 9739 …if (mode_lib->ms.cache_display_cfg.writeback.WritebackEnable[k] == true && mode_lib->ms.cache_disp… in dml_core_mode_programming() 9740 …th = mode_lib->ms.cache_display_cfg.writeback.WritebackDestinationWidth[k] * mode_lib->ms.cache_di… in dml_core_mode_programming() 9743 …th = mode_lib->ms.cache_display_cfg.writeback.WritebackDestinationWidth[k] * mode_lib->ms.cache_di… in dml_core_mode_programming() [all …]
|
| /drivers/iommu/ |
| A D | virtio-iommu.c | 84 void *writeback; member 177 if (req->writeback && len == write_len) in __viommu_sync_req() 178 memcpy(req->writeback, req->buf + req->write_offset, in __viommu_sync_req() 219 bool writeback) in __viommu_add_req() argument 239 if (writeback) { in __viommu_add_req() 240 req->writeback = buf + write_offset; in __viommu_add_req()
|
| /drivers/block/ |
| A D | virtio_blk.c | 1064 u8 writeback; in virtblk_get_cache_mode() local 1069 &writeback); in virtblk_get_cache_mode() 1076 writeback = virtio_has_feature(vdev, VIRTIO_BLK_F_FLUSH); in virtblk_get_cache_mode() 1078 return writeback; in virtblk_get_cache_mode() 1118 u8 writeback = virtblk_get_cache_mode(vblk->vdev); in cache_type_show() local 1120 BUG_ON(writeback >= ARRAY_SIZE(virtblk_cache_types)); in cache_type_show() 1121 return sysfs_emit(buf, "%s\n", virtblk_cache_types[writeback]); in cache_type_show()
|
| /drivers/gpu/drm/amd/display/dc/dml2/dml21/inc/ |
| A D | dml_top_soc_parameter_types.h | 80 } writeback; member
|
| A D | dml_top_display_cfg_types.h | 409 struct dml2_writeback_cfg writeback; member
|
| /drivers/gpu/drm/amd/display/dc/dml2/dml21/src/dml2_core/ |
| A D | dml2_core_dcn4_calcs.c | 7852 s->mSOCParameters.WritebackLatency = mode_lib->soc.qos_parameters.writeback.base_latency_us; in dml_core_ms_prefetch_check() 8121 …dex].writeback.writeback_stream[0].h_ratio > (unsigned int)display_cfg->stream_descriptors[display… in dml_core_mode_support() 8122 …dex].writeback.writeback_stream[0].v_ratio > (unsigned int)display_cfg->stream_descriptors[display… in dml_core_mode_support() 8123 …_index].writeback.writeback_stream[0].h_taps > 2.0 && ((display_cfg->stream_descriptors[display_cf… in dml_core_mode_support() 10245 if (p->display_cfg->stream_descriptors[k].writeback.active_writebacks_per_stream > 0) in CalculateStutterEfficiency() 10945 mode_lib->soc.qos_parameters.writeback.base_latency_us in dml_core_mode_programming() 11647 s->mmSOCParameters.WritebackLatency = mode_lib->soc.qos_parameters.writeback.base_latency_us; in dml_core_mode_programming() 11896 if (display_cfg->stream_descriptors[k].writeback.active_writebacks_per_stream > 0) { in dml_core_mode_programming() 11897 s->WRBandwidth = display_cfg->stream_descriptors[k].writeback.writeback_stream[0].output_height in dml_core_mode_programming() 11898 * display_cfg->stream_descriptors[k].writeback.writeback_stream[0].output_width / in dml_core_mode_programming() [all …]
|